Re: Water Softener
Starting with hard water - hard water has large amounts of calcium carbonate dissolved in it, this prevents soaps and detergents working, and where the water is heated the calcium carbonate will come out of solution, deposit on the hot surface. Re: Puzzling eGFR results
Hi Genevieve189,
Welcome to the forum.
eGFR is an estimate, and is notorious for its inaccuracy, it also sensitive to the amount you have eaten drunk that day.
It is best to consider trends rather than one reading on it's own.
